I took the Naturehike Mongar 2 Person Tent on a 3-day hiking trip and was impressed. The tent packs light and is easy to carry, fitting snugly into my backpack. Setting it up was a breeze and took under 10 minutes, thanks to the clear instructions.
The high-quality green 20D nylon felt sturdy and withstood some strong winds and light rain. It's not the roomiest for two people, but we managed to store our gear comfortably, thanks to the double doors and vestibules. Overall, it's a solid choice for lightweight backpacking.

Bought this for a weekend camping trip, and it exceeded expectations. The Naturehike Mongar Tent is ultra-lightweight and the perfect companion for our hiking adventures. I loved the double layer, which provided extra weather protection.
It vented well, keeping us cool even when temperatures climbed during the day. The tent stakes were a bit flimsy, but we managed by placing rocks over them. I would recommend this to anyone looking for a budget-friendly, quality tent that doesn’t weigh you down.
